Celebrities Affected by the 2025 Los Angeles Wildfires: Heartbreak and Resilience

The 2025 Los Angeles wildfires have left a trail of destruction across Southern California, devastating communities and impacting numerous celebrities. These fires, fueled by severe drought and high winds, have destroyed homes in Pacific Palisades, Malibu, and the Hollywood Hills, forcing evacuations and disrupting lives. Many high-profile figures have taken to social media to share their experiences, express their heartbreak, and encourage support for relief efforts.

Heidi Montag and Spencer Pratt: A Heartfelt Loss

Reality TV stars Heidi Montag and Spencer Pratt were among the celebrities who lost their homes in the Pacific Palisades fire. Montag posted an emotional message on Instagram, sharing a photo of their destroyed residence with the caption:
“Our hearts are broken. The memories, the love, and the life we built here are gone. But we’re thankful to be safe.”

Billy Crystal: Words Cannot Describe the Pain

Legendary actor Billy Crystal and his wife, Janice, also lost their Pacific Palisades home to the wildfire. Crystal shared his heartbreak on Twitter, writing:
“The loss is indescribable. We are safe, but this tragedy has touched us deeply.”

Paris Hilton: Losing a Piece of History

Socialite and entrepreneur Paris Hilton was devastated when her home in the Malibu Hills was engulfed by flames. Hilton shared on TikTok and Instagram Stories, describing the fire as a “personal tragedy” and recalling the countless memories tied to her residence.

“It’s not just a house—it’s a part of my family’s history. My heart is with everyone affected by these fires.”

Mandy Moore: Forced to Flee

Actress and singer Mandy Moore had to evacuate her Hollywood Hills home as flames rapidly approached. Though her home was spared, Moore took to Instagram to express her gratitude to first responders and the community for their support. She wrote:
“I’m safe, but so many are not. Let’s come together to help those who have lost everything.”

Jamie Lee Curtis: A Loss Beyond Measure

Jamie Lee Curtis, the celebrated actress and advocate, was among the many affected by the 2025 Los Angeles wildfires. Curtis, known for her roles in iconic films and her humanitarian efforts, lost her family home in the Malibu Hills. The property, which she often referred to as her “sanctuary,” held decades of personal memories and heirlooms.

Curtis took to Instagram to share her grief, posting a photo of the charred remains of her home with the caption:
“My heart aches for everyone affected by this disaster. We’ve lost a piece of our history, but I am grateful for the safety of my loved ones.”
